4

I am developing a Java application that should be able to connect to any Salesforce org and use the Tooling Api.

Salesforce provides a WSDL but as I understand it is org specific, correct ?

Could someone please explain how to approach this problem ?

Appreciate your help, Thanks

1 Answer 1

3

Only the Enterprise API is Org specific.

The Tooling API will work with any org providing the user has API access. In addition to API access the user making the API calls may require additional permissions, such as "View All Data" to query Tooling API objects.

2
  • Thanks Daniel. So I can use the objects configured in the WSDL after I login to SF using WSC or any other login flow ? Correct ?
    – sfdcdev
    Mar 26, 2017 at 20:53
  • Assuming the user who is logged in has the required permissions, then yes. Like the Partner API, the Tooling API should be Metadata driven. It will adjust what it exposes to the user based on their level of access. Mar 26, 2017 at 20:55

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.